Block 1: Buildings in a New Reality – Challenges for Modern FM

Changing requirements for CO₂ and energy efficiency, new technological trends, and growing safety risks fundamentally change how properties are managed. This block will explore technical solutions and approaches shaping tomorrow’s facility management and how managers, developers, and investors can prepare their buildings for the future.

Presentation: CO₂ emissions are changing the market: Buildings that won’t survive the future.

Climate change and increasing requirements to reduce carbon footprints are fundamentally altering market conditions in energy. Buildings with high CO₂ emissions become risky assets – not only legally, but also in investment attractiveness. The presentation will highlight the necessity of decarbonization and provide practical examples from the private sector. The goal is to question whether the Slovak market is prepared for the decarbonization pressure already shaping decision-making in Western Europe.

Presentation: Smart Buildings, Smart Threats: Integrated Security for the New World.

Modern buildings are no longer just concrete, glass, and air conditioning. They are living ecosystems of data, sensors, and connected technologies providing comfort, efficiency, and new challenges. Each “smart” function opens doors to new threats – from cyberattacks on building management systems to physical breaches. The presentation explains why physical and cyber security must go hand in hand to protect people, data, and infrastructure, with practical examples of AI, IoT, and security technology integration.

Presentation: When noise kills KPIs – Turning it to benefit people and buildings.

What links facility managers’ KPIs with spatial acoustics? User comfort. Despite mandated returns to offices, some resist, and others struggle to be productive due to noisy environments. Latest UK acoustic study: 56% find workplaces too noisy, 81% say noise affects productivity, 30% feel stressed. Noise impacts space usage, user satisfaction, and cost-efficiency per m².
